Abuja Land Acquisition And Fraudulent Activities by TushyLapazz(op):
Of recent, their has been increase in property scam/fraud within the FCT. Some of the few reasons are, not limited to 1) patronage of unskilled and inexperience consultants (lawyers, estate surveyors, agents, land surveyors). Not all professionals in this industry are good with land matters, a lot are just after the fee the stand to enjoy. Hence their target is to close the purchase deal, not minding d authenticity and ensuring due process is not compromised. 2) Purchasing on trust. If u twin brother wants to sell a property to u, pls do your independent search. 3) As a land surveyor, I found out that most land scammers collaborate with individuals who parade themselves as surveyors. Hence, I advice u employ a honest regd Surveyor independently to help verify location against title documents. 4) As much as possible be very careful with area council's title documents, as most of them r not very verifiable, hence 50/50 chances. A visit to courts within Fct, will reveal 80/90% of land cases are area councils. With a vision to help investors in this sector.
